A shocking dashcam video captured the moment a bolt of lightning struck an electric pole, causing a nearby transformer to erupt into a massive fireball

The dramatic footage was recorded from a police vehicle in Mount Pleasant, South Carolina, in the US on Monday, 11 August 2025.

The incident, which occurred around 11am on Highway 17, resulted in downed power lines, widespread outages, and traffic delays that lasted for roughly three hours.

The Mount Pleasant Police Department shared the video on X (formerly Twitter), stating, "A bit too much excitement for a Monday! The lightning strike caused our power outages and traffic delays. Fortunately, no one was injured."

Social media users were quick to express their shock at the raw power of the strike, with one person commenting, "Good Lord! Looks like a war movie!"

In a surprising twist, one user identified themselves as the driver of the car directly in front of the police vehicle.

"That's me driving right in front of the police vehicle! My windscreen was smashed and some scratches from the downed wires. Thankfully I wasn't hurt, and it doesn't look like anyone else was either," they wrote.
